Peter Andrew Willis (born 16 February 1960) is an English musician, songwriter and guitarist, best known as a founding member of the band Def Leppard. He co-wrote many tracks and played guitar on the band's first three albums: On Through the Night, High 'n' Dry, and Pyromania, which was being recorded at the time of his departure. He was fired from Def Leppard in 1982 and replaced by Phil Collen. Ppl don't realize today that the Def Leppard they see in concert does not consist of any of the original guitarists... fees for social housing regulationWeb20. mar 2024 · Original Def Leppard guitarist Pete Willis was fired from the band in London, England on this day in 1982. Pete had been drinking way too much during the making of the Pyromania album. One incident where he could barely play on a recording session for ‘Stagefright’ led the band to finally ask him to leave.
